Output adeca8bb77de19462bd624de53e685840d25c8e3f11d67b013242593c5bd0a76:0

value
12500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9109a5a71a27e54163bc5b206b75889d1e77577e OP_EQUAL
address
3EuuTefD275MPfr43Q9YPbhsGuU2tngLpL
transaction
adeca8bb77de19462bd624de53e685840d25c8e3f11d67b013242593c5bd0a76
confirmations
452532
spent
true